Output 04cc569562e65b0ae84d71dd322def291815d123a78dda93abad328bd30bce57:2

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 671418e77fd2e9085c1ec66ecb79e5db8f39cb55 OP_EQUAL
address
3B63bgjnR9cYUgAroLHoUx6JviSQef4Gdo
transaction
04cc569562e65b0ae84d71dd322def291815d123a78dda93abad328bd30bce57
confirmations
439550
spent
true